Market Overview: Why Evening Handbags Remain a Strategic SKU
Evening handbags, from compact minaudieres to elegant clutches and chain-strap Shoulder Bags, are often impulse purchases tied to events, holidays, and gift-giving seasons. For retailers, they deliver:
– High perceived value with relatively low production cost.
– Seasonal spikes around weddings, prom, holiday parties, and cultural events.
– Strong cross-sell opportunities alongside dresses, shoes, and accessories.

Quality Control and Compliance: Ensuring Consistent Evening Luxury
For B2B buyers, consistent quality equals fewer returns and stronger retail reputation. PrinceBag typically applies:
– Incoming material inspection protocols for fabrics, hardware, and trims.
– In-process checks at key production stages (cutting, assembly, attachment of hardware, finishing).
– Final random-sample inspections and AQL (Acceptable Quality Limit) testing.
– Compliance with material safety standards (lead-free hardware, restricted substances testing like REACH or CPSIA where applicable).
Buyers should request inspection reports, lab certificates, and consider third-party QC audits for large orders.

Logistics, Lead Times, and Minimum Order Planning
Efficient logistics planning is essential for B2B buyers ordering evening handbags in bulk:
– Lead Times: Typical production lead times range from 30 to 70 days depending on complexity, season, and factory load. Embellished pieces may require longer.
– Shipping Options: FOB (Factory) or CIF options are common. Air freight suits urgent smaller batches; ocean freight reduces cost per unit for larger orders.
– Inventory Planning: Time your orders ahead of peak seasons—weddings and holidays require buffer lead times and contingency stock.
– Incoterms & Responsibility: Clarify responsibilities (packaging, export documentation, insurance) and whether PrinceBag handles consolidation or direct shipment.
Sample, Prototype, and Production Workflow
A healthy B2B relationship follows a predictable sample-to-production path:
1. Inquiry and specification: Provide tech packs, references, or design sketches.
2. Quotation: PrinceBag returns pricing, lead times, and MOQ guidance.
3. Sample approval: Pre-production sample (PPS) or custom sample created. Expect a fee and 7–21 days turnaround.
4. Final adjustments: Fit, material, and hardware corrections are made until sign-off.
5. Production: Factory begins bulk production once deposit and PO are confirmed.
6. QC & Shipping: Inspections occur pre-shipment; balance payment is released, then goods ship.
Buyers should budget for sample fees and include a small percentage of sample-to-production discrepancy in their timeline.

Negotiation Tips and Contract Essentials for B2B Buyers
When negotiating factory-direct terms with PrinceBag, consider:
– Volume Discounts: Ask for tiered pricing with clear thresholds.
– Payment Terms: Negotiate deposits and balance schedules—consider letters of credit for large orders.
– Penalties & Remedies: Include late-delivery penalties or replacement terms for defect rates exceeding agreed AQLs.
– Intellectual Property: Clarify IP ownership for custom designs and use restrictive clauses against unauthorized replication.
– Sample & Tooling Credits: Negotiate for sample fees or tooling costs to be credited against first production runs if possible.
– Long-Term Agreement: Consider framework contracts for rolling orders to lock in pricing and capacity.

Risk Management and Quality Assurance Best Practices
To mitigate order risk:
– Start with smaller trial orders to validate quality and market acceptance.
– Use third-party inspections at critical stages or pre-shipment to verify quantities and defects.
– Require photo documentation of batches and packaging before shipping.
– Maintain a buffer stock strategy for bestsellers and fast-follow reorder terms.
– Track returns and customer feedback to inform future orders and product tweaks.
